NextJS build failed because of `ReferenceError: CustomEvent is not defined`

Steps already taken

After going through the issues section in this repo, I found a closed issue that addressed this error. I tried dynamic importing the modules as shown here. This did not fix it either, or perhaps I missed something.

My repo state in which the error is observed - https://github.com/shricodev/pdfwhisper-openai/tree/50705dd06f9c78327f1a5241c91845d0daad4c5f

However, I found a fix to use

export const dynamic = "force-dynamic";

in layout.tsx to fix the error that was not letting me build the application. But, on running

pnpm run start

The error is again seen in the console:

Hey @shricodev dynamic import importing the component when using it, fixes this issue. Have you tried that

import dynamic from 'next/dynamic';
const HankoAuth = dynamic(() => import('@/components/HankoAuth'), { ssr: false })

export default function LoginPage() {
 return (
   <HankoAuth />
 );
}

You can also find it in the docs, it has been updated
https://docs.hanko.io/quickstarts/fullstack/next
